This
makes no sense to me. The only reason Edge might "smell more", being the exact same thing with more alcohol and
water, is that you can use more fluid volume and spread it over a larger area for more evaporation. If you used the
same amont of liquid, Edge would smell much less, especially after the initial minute of rapid alcohol evaporation.
(You can't judge smell on the initial burst of alcohol evaporation)
But Edge used modestly, especially if
spread out to multiple application points, will not stink. I can make one dab cover six application points, and you
could cover your whole body with 2-4 dabs (1-4 dabs is the range of effectiveness for most). Again, if you are
stinking, you are either OD'ing or not using a cover scent. (There are exceptions, of course, like in the case of
Gegogi who has to use ridiculous levels that are an OD for everyone else). Further, Edge does not stink when you get
one of the many scented versions. NPA has no scented version. At one dab, (I don't believe anyone but experienced
users should attempt to spray Edge, since that's an instant OD for many) Edge improves the overall smell of
my cologne-pheromone complex!
Use scented Edge (the sandalwood one goes with every cover scent, but I use the
cedar "Arouser") in moderation with a cover scent, and you will have no problems with stink.
Why would you be
willing to OD on NPA or anything else?? That makes no sense. If you use Edge you won't OD. If you use NPA you will,
unless you are a freak of nature.
NPA "doesn't stink as bad" (it smells exactly the same because it is
exactly the same) only because it is confined to a pinhead application point where it can't disperse. It's
impossible to get enough fluid to spread NPA out without an OD. But you could almost say that if it ain't stinking,
it ain't working, because larger areas of dispersal have long been known to be better. So Edge is also going to
work better.
Some of you people just cannot understand, or will not open your minds, to the fact that just
because something stinks in huge quantities doesn't mean it can't smell fantastic in judicious amounts, especially
in combination with other things. That is one of the main principles and insights of perfuming.
Nowhere is it
more true than in the case of Edge, scented or not. Learn to use it properly and you will be rewarded.
